This week: thankful patients talk about their experiences with their surgeons

Among the blessings for which Timothy Hudson and Edward St. George are thankful is the medical care they each received when they faced separate health crises earlier this year.

Timothy Hudson’s kidneys were failing when his son decided to donate one of his kidneys. He recalls the experience with transplant surgeon, Dr. Vaughn Whittaker.

Edward St. George broke his neck in a fall over the summer. He and neurosurgeon Dr. Lawrence Chin explain how careful emergency response made the difference in his recovery.

Also this week, when to take away an aging loved one’s car keys, and Deirdre Neilen reads from Upstate Medical University’s literary journal, The Healing Muse.
